Output ef5da79a005079d2a5c6d9314b056bb59977bc31bbd6a88abd3b5719ee406f60:0

value
1621800
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2b4a871935bf5ecbde8df07787fe5e7f19659ad6 OP_EQUALVERIFY OP_CHECKSIG
address
14wuLXWff7w3haA9kZfQgGbqP8nYLkx1Dv
transaction
ef5da79a005079d2a5c6d9314b056bb59977bc31bbd6a88abd3b5719ee406f60
confirmations
403850
spent
true